Afzelechin is a flavan-3-ol, a type of flavonoid. It can be found in Bergenia ligulata ( a.k.a. Paashaanbhed in Ayurveda traditional Indian medicine). [1] It exists as at least 2 major epimers (afzelechin and epi-afzelechin).
(2R,3S)-catechin:NADP+ 4-oxidoreductase transforms cis-3,4-leucopelargonidin into afzelechin. [2]
Arthromerin A ( afzelechin-3-O-β-D-xylopyranoside) and arthromerin B ( afzelechin-3-O-β-D-glucopyranoside) are afzelechin glycosides isolated from the roots of the fern Arthromeris mairei. [3] (+)-afzelechin-O-β-4'-D-glucopyranoside can be isolated from the rhizomes of the fern Selliguea feei. [4]
Afzelechin-(4alpha→8)-afzelechin (molecular formula : C30H26O10, molar mass : 546.52 g/mol, exact mass : 546.152597, CAS number : 101339-37-1, Pubchem CID : 12395) is a
B type proanthocyanidin.
Ent-epiafzelechin-3-O-p-hydroxybenzoate-(4α→8,2α→O→7)-epiafzelechin) is an
A-type proanthocyanidin found in
apricots (Prunus armeniaca).
[5]
Selligueain A (epiafzelechin-(4β-8,2β-0-7)-epiafzelechin-(4β-8)-afzelechin) is an A type proanthocyanidin.
